Sensitivity of zinc kinetics and nutritional assessment of children submitted to venous zinc tolerance test.

Abstract

OBJECTIVE: The purposes of this study were to investigate the kinetics of zinc in schoolchildren between the ages of 6 and 9 years, of both sexes, and to verify its sensitivity in detecting alterations in body zinc status.
METHODS: Nutritional assessment was performed by body mass index. Food intake, venous zinc tolerance test, and zinc kinetics were carried out before and after 3-month oral zinc supplementation.
RESULTS: Of the 42 children studied, 76.2% had healthy weight. Only energy, calcium, and fiber intake were suboptimal before and after oral zinc supplementation. Serum zinc and total-body zinc clearance, although at normal levels, increased significantly after zinc supplementation.
CONCLUSION: We concluded, therefore, that kinetics is a sensitive tool for detecting changes in body zinc status, even in children without a deficiency of this mineral. Furthermore, kinetics showed a positive response to supplementation and may be a sensitive parameter for evaluating the efficacy of this therapy.
